Cool growing miniature orchid which grow at high altitude in Central and South America.
These are ideal for terrariums as they enjoy the humidity created in that environment.
Clump forming plants with thick leaves on a thin stem.
The flowers are produced where the leaf meets the stem and they can bloom several times a year in any season.
The exquisite flowers have detailed patterning, best seen with a magnifying glass!
Grow in a minimum 10°C in Winter, shaded in summer and damp all year.
They are potted in a mix of sphagnum moss and Perlite to help them keep moist.
Mist leaves regularly to increase the humidity
1.5" flowers.
Pink flowers with tiny dark purple spots.
